机器人编程条件是什么
-
机器人编程条件包括以下几个方面:
-
编程知识:机器人编程需要具备一定的编程知识,掌握至少一种编程语言,如C++、Python等。对于机器人控制和运动规划方面的编程,还需要了解相关算法和技术。
-
机器人硬件平台:不同的机器人硬件平台有不同的编程要求,需要了解所使用机器人的硬件结构和功能,以便进行正确的编程。
-
传感器和感知技术:机器人编程需要通过传感器获取环境信息,并进行相应的感知和决策。因此,对于传感器技术和相关算法的了解是必要的。
-
控制和运动规划:机器人的控制和运动规划需要编程实现。在编程时需要了解机器人的动力学模型和控制算法,以及运动规划算法。
-
问题解决能力:机器人编程常常涉及到解决复杂的问题和处理各种异常情况。需要具备良好的问题解决能力和逻辑思维能力,能够分析和解决编程中遇到的各种困难和挑战。
总之,机器人编程需要具备编程知识、机器人硬件平台理解、传感器和感知技术、控制和运动规划的相关知识,以及良好的问题解决能力。
1年前 -
-
机器人编程的条件主要包括以下几个方面:
-
掌握编程语言:机器人编程需要掌握至少一种编程语言,常见的包括C/C++、Python、Java等。掌握编程语言能帮助开发者理解和编写机器人的代码,实现各种功能。
-
熟悉机器人操作系统:机器人操作系统(ROS)是一种开源的操作系统,专门用于机器人的开发和控制。熟悉ROS可以帮助开发者更好地使用机器人的硬件和软件资源,实现机器人的各种功能。
-
了解机器人硬件:机器人编程还需要开发者了解机器人的硬件系统,包括传感器、执行器、控制器等。了解机器人硬件可以帮助开发者编写与硬件配合的程序代码,实现机器人的各种动作和功能。
-
具备数学和算法基础:机器人编程涉及到许多数学和算法的知识,如几何学、运动学、机器人路径规划等。具备良好的数学和算法基础可以帮助开发者理解和应用相关的知识,实现机器人的高效运动和强智能。
-
具备问题解决能力:机器人编程是一个复杂的过程,常常面临各种技术和实际问题。开发者需要具备良好的问题解决能力,能够分析和解决遇到的困难和挑战。通过不断学习和实践,开发者可以提高自己的技术水平,更好地应对机器人编程的需求。
总结起来,机器人编程的条件包括掌握编程语言、熟悉机器人操作系统、了解机器人硬件、具备数学和算法基础以及具备问题解决能力。只有具备这些条件,才能编写出高效、智能的机器人程序。
1年前 -
-
机器人编程是指为机器人设计、开发和实现一系列操作指令的过程。要进行机器人编程,需要满足以下条件:
-
硬件设备:需要有一台可编程的机器人设备,如机器人机械臂、机器人小车等。这些设备通常包括传感器、执行器和处理器等组件,用于感知环境、执行动作和处理数据。
-
编程语言:机器人编程需要使用特定的编程语言来编写指令。常见的机器人编程语言包括C++、Python、Java等。不同的编程语言有不同的特点和用途,选择合适的编程语言取决于机器人应用的具体需求。
-
开发环境:编程机器人需要一个合适的开发环境,用于编写、调试和测试代码。这些开发环境可以是集成开发环境(IDE)或文本编辑器,可以提供代码自动补全、调试功能等。
-
算法与逻辑思维:机器人编程需要掌握基础的算法和逻辑思维能力。例如,明白如何使用条件语句、循环语句和函数等来控制机器人的行为,实现特定的任务。
-
强调实践:机器人编程是一种实践性很强的技能,需要通过大量的实践来提高自己的编程能力。通过不断实践,可以积累经验并熟悉机器人的特点和行为。
-
学习资源:要学习机器人编程,可以通过书籍、在线教程、视频教程等多种学习资源进行学习。此外,还可以参加机器人编程的培训班和工作坊,获取更系统的知识和技能。
总结来说,机器人编程需要有合适的硬件设备、编程语言、开发环境,以及算法与逻辑思维能力。通过实践和学习资源的支持,可以不断提高机器人编程的能力和技巧。
1年前 -